Transaction 3169144b23bdb177a97182c18404575fc84d29427229e3cc9c775e5a895555a2
1 Input
1 Output
-
3169144b23bdb177a97182c18404575fc84d29427229e3cc9c775e5a895555a2:0
- value
- 124420530
- script pubkey
- OP_0 OP_PUSHBYTES_20 4f0db91639f353dcdf6af265356c411fa83f11d3
- address
- bc1qfuxmj93e7dfaehm27fjn2mzpr75r7ywnsyhl3z